'The Last Crusaders' is a narrative history about the carnage of Lepanto, the conquests of Don Juan, the pyramid of Spanish skulls that Dragut built in Jerba, about how the Spanish stabled their horses on a litter of Korans, and the life of galley slaves, gunpowder, the casting of cannon and gold.
